The final price for your chimney service depends on a few straightforward factors. We look at the total height of your chimney, the level of creosote buildup inside the flue, and the specific type of fireplace or wood stove you have installed. If your system requires extra repairs, damper adjustments, or a specialized animal nest removal, that will naturally adjust the total. When you hire a local team, they come out to inspect your flue and remove hazardous creosote buildup. This is essential for preventing house fires and ensuring your fireplace vents smoke properly. You should schedule this service once a year, or sooner if you notice heavy soot accumulation. Local companies are great because they understand regional building codes and climate-related issues, helping you keep your heating system running safely throughout the colder months of the year.
Summer is often overlooked, but it is actually a great time to service your chimney. Technicians have more availability, making it easier to book a time that fits your schedule. Additionally, clearing out debris before the rainy season helps prevent moisture-related issues that can lead to unpleasant odors or structural damage. Annual chimney cleaning is generally recommended for Detroit homes, especially if you use your fireplace often. If your fireplace is used sparingly, an inspection every two years might be enough. Licensed pros can assess your usage and recommend the best schedule for your Detroit home.
The best time to schedule chimney cleaning in Detroit is typically in the spring or early fall. This is before the cold weather hits and you start using your fireplace regularly. It also helps avoid the rush of appointments during the peak heating season. This ensures your chimney is ready when you need it in Detroit.
